Autor |
Nachricht |
slein
Threadersteller
Dabei seit: 02.10.2002
Ort: -
Alter: 42
Geschlecht:
|
Verfasst Di 14.09.2004 11:30
Titel BCC mail mit php |
|
|
Hey Leute,
weiß einer von euch wie ich bei 'ner HTML-Mail die ich via php verschicke eine BLINDKOPIE verschicke?
Also das nicht alle Adressen aufgeführt sind im Header (handelt sich hier um 'nen Newsletter!).
Wäre supa von euch!
ROCK 'N ROLL!
der die das sleiN
|
|
|
|
|
Eistee
Administrator
Dabei seit: 31.10.2001
Ort: Grimma
Alter: 45
Geschlecht:
|
Verfasst Di 14.09.2004 11:31
Titel
|
|
|
Einfach den entsprechenden header an die mail() Funktion geben.
Aber bedenke: Jeder der nicht ganz blöd ist kann sich die Mail-Header anzeigen lassen, und hat dann alle Mail Addressen.
|
|
|
|
|
Anzeige
|
|
|
Anti78
Dabei seit: 16.09.2003
Ort: Tbb/Mz/M
Alter: 46
Geschlecht:
|
Verfasst Di 14.09.2004 11:33
Titel
|
|
|
Für einen Newsletter gibts auch gute Progs. Wie z.B. SuperMailer.
|
|
|
|
|
dastef
Dabei seit: 03.11.2003
Ort: -
Alter: -
Geschlecht:
|
Verfasst Di 14.09.2004 12:44
Titel
|
|
|
zusätzlich gibt's auch zu beachten, dass nich jeder server eine
beliebige anzahl an bcc-empfänger mit macht ..
|
|
|
|
|
pRiMUS
Dabei seit: 09.09.2003
Ort: Vienna
Alter: 48
Geschlecht:
|
|
|
|
|
rob
Dabei seit: 11.12.2003
Ort: ~/
Alter: 46
Geschlecht:
|
Verfasst Di 14.09.2004 13:19
Titel
|
|
|
Zitat: | Aber bedenke: Jeder der nicht ganz blöd ist kann sich die Mail-Header anzeigen lassen, und hat dann alle Mail Addressen |
Stehen die da sicher alle drin? Ich bin jetzt ein wenig verunsichert...
Ich dachte, daß bei jedem der im BCC steht nur der zusätzliche Header Delivered-To:Original-Empfänger mit drin steht.
Sicher, daß die anderen BCC-Empfänger auch aufgeführt werden? Das sollte ich vielleicht mal testen...
Also der Originalempfänger der Mail sieht in jedem Fall nichts von den BCC-Empfängern - auch nicht in den Headern - sonst wäre das ja sinnlos. Hier müßte man sich also schon mal keine Sorgen machen...
Naja und die Lösung alle Empfänger per BCC zu übergeben ist wohl nicht so sinnvoll. Ich glaube nicht, daß ein Server das mitmacht, wenn man hier vielleicht 1000 Adressen übergeben will.
Wenn man aber Mails an alle Personen verschickt, die sich für den Newsletter eingetragen haben, und dazu eine Schleife benutzt, dann kann es bei vielen Mails passieren, daß das PHP-Script zu lange läuft und abbricht (Einstellung in der php.ini - meist bei 30 Sekunden).
Und bei nicht jedem Provider kann man da selber eine andere Zeit setzen.
Ich habe das für jemanden gerade so gemacht, daß ich immer 100 Adressen aus einer DB holen und diese dann verschicke, danach ruft sich das Script dann selbst auf und verschickt die nächsten Mails. In der DB setze ich ein Flag um zu sehen, welche Mails schon verschickt wurden.
|
|
|
|
|
Eistee
Administrator
Dabei seit: 31.10.2001
Ort: Grimma
Alter: 45
Geschlecht:
|
Verfasst Di 14.09.2004 13:49
Titel
|
|
|
Hm, jetzt bin ich mir auch nimma sicher. Ein Test hat grad ergeben, das zumindest unser Mailserver die BCC Header rausfiltert.
|
|
|
|
|
donnerchen
Dabei seit: 06.04.2003
Ort: -
Alter: 53
Geschlecht:
|
Verfasst Mi 15.09.2004 09:14
Titel
|
|
|
BCC-Empfänger stehen nicht in der Mail. Grundsätzlich werden die von dem Mailserver rausgefiltert. Daher heißt das ja auch BLIND Carbon Copy. So weit ich weiß gab es vor Jharen mal eine Version des Exchange-Servers der die versehentlich im Header belassen hat. Ist aber inzwischen kein Problem mehr.
|
|
|
|
|
|
|
|
Ähnliche Themen |
HTML-E-Mail | Textumbrüche bei einem langen E-Mail-Text
[PHP] E-Mail in DB
Mail via Php
[php] mail
Größe PDF Mail
e-mail hintergrundgrafik
|
|